    Life guard swim suit- 1950's?

    It has to be '60s because of the Union Label. If it didn't have the label, I would have guessed '50s from the suit. This label was used from 1963-1974. The lifeguard patches probably didn't change that much. https://vintagefashionguild.org/label-resource/union-label/ Too bad about the...

    Identify this

    The clip you are showing is a "Dress Clip." They were used from the late 1920s into the 1950s - often in pairs, sometimes to change the necklines of dresses or gowns and sometimes just for decoration. If you would like to learn more about them, there is some discussion of dress clips in...
